Season Finale. The final confrontation regarding the secrets buried in Split River High's history.
Peyton List, Josh Zuckerman, Milo Manheim, Spencer MacPherson, Sarah Yarkin, Kristian Ventura, Kiara Pichardo, Nick Pugliese, Rainbow Wedell
Drama, Supernatural, Fantasy
Watch School Spirits Season 03 Episode 08 123movies for free in HD quality. Stream instantly with English subtitles — no download or account needed.